Teams managed

03/2022 - 06/2022 Raja Casablanca Manager
01/2019 - 11/2019 Olympique de Khouribga Manager
07/2018 - 11/2018 ES Sétif Manager
01/2018 - 06/2018 CR Bélouizdad Manager
08/2016 - 11/2017 RS Berkane Manager
11/2015 - 06/2016 Raja Casablanca Manager
01/2015 - 11/2015 Maghrib de Fès Manager
10/2013 - 12/2014 FAR de Rabat Manager
07/2012 - 12/2012 FAR de Rabat Manager
07/2009 - 06/2012 Maghrib de Fès Manager
07/2006 - 06/2008 FUS de Rabat Manager
07/2003 - 06/2006 KAC de Kénitra Manager
07/2001 - 06/2003 Wydad AC Manager
07/1998 - 06/1999 FAR de Rabat Manager
07/1991 - 06/1993 US Sidi Kacem Manager

National teams managed

Club career

07/1990 - 06/1992 US Sidi Kacem Midfielder
07/1989 - 06/1990 FAR de Rabat Midfielder
07/1977 - 06/1989 US Sidi Kacem Midfielder